Sandra holds a Ph.D. in Applications of Informatics from the University of Alicante, Spain, and a Master in Software Engineering from Drexel University, USA. Sandra is a researcher and professor at the Department of Informatics and Computer Sciences of the National Polytechnic School of Ecuador. Her main research interests include Sofware Quality, Human-Computer Interaction, Web Accessibility, MOOCs, and Engineering Education. She has been Ecuador's Representative to Hispanic America Software Testing Qualifications Board. She has published in indexed scientific journals such as IEEE Access (SJR Q1), Journal of Educational Computing Research (SJR Q1), Journal of Software: Evolution and Proces (SJR Q2), Journal of Universal Computer Science (SJR Q2), Computer Standards and Interfaces (SJR Q2), Universal Access in the Information Society (SJR Q2), Applied Sciences (SJR Q2), International Journal of Engineering Education (SJR Q2), IEEE Latin America Transactions (SJR Q3), and RISTI - Revista Iberica de Sistemas e Tecnologias de Informacao (SJR Q4). Sandra has 30 years of experience in teaching at the graduate and undergraduate levels and 28 years of experience in the development and implementation of software solutions in Ecuador, Panama, and the USA.
